About the role
This job is a member of the Airport Stations Team within the Customer Experience Division. You’ll perform a wide variety of office duties, supporting both daily operations and special projects to keep our airport stations running smoothly.
Responsibilities
- Coordinate meeting arrangements, typing, filing, telephone coverage, customer greetings, mail handling, and office supply orders.
- Assist with preparation of management presentations and special projects.
- Administer, review, and monitor local invoices through InvoiceWorks and disseminate as necessary.
- Troubleshoot and escalate office technology issues, including telephone and copier machines.
- Track and ensure employees complete onboarding duties (system access, lockers, mailboxes, uniforms, badges, fingerprinting, training, etc.).
- Assist in station event planning, coordination, and execution (e.g., Do Crew, luncheons, holiday meals, recognition events).
- Handle payroll processing in Workbrain for management and support staff.
- Process bereavement letters and coordinate local communications and responses.
- Manage employee parking, including permitting and assignments.
- Assist with timekeeping functions, data entry, verification, reconciliations, and filing.
- Maintain employee files and station meeting plans, including monthly emergency response.
- Access and manage periodic reports (performance, audit, expense, employee engagement, recognition, etc.).
- Update required manuals and maintain all security-related items.
- Act as backup for various payroll functions.
- Manage records for OSHA, safety, etc. (301’s, weekly, and annual).
- Assist with budget preparation, reconciliation, and monthly closeout of landing fees.
- Support auditing activities as required.
- Track and verify incentive funds earned.
- Liaise with CRE/Facilities and vendors to track local projects.
- Lead/direct work with other support staff as needed.
- Perform other duties as required.
